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
At any trusted exercise bike shop, you are likely to experience a number of kinds of exercise bikes. Understanding the distinctions can assist individuals decide that lines up with their fitness goals.
1. Upright BikesDeveloped Similar to a Traditional Bicycle: These bikes are excellent for those who desire a reasonable biking experience.Space-Efficient: Generally smaller in size, making them appropriate for home use.2. Recumbent BikesComfort-Oriented Design: These bikes include a reclined position with a bigger seat and back assistance.Reduced Strain: Excellent for individuals with back issues or limited mobility.3. Spin BikesHigh-Intensity Workouts: Designed generally for interval training, they use a more intense biking experience.Adjustable Resistance: Allows for personalization of the exercise intensity.4. Air BikesFull-Body Workout: These bikes make use of air resistance and often include handlebars, permitting users to engage the upper body.Self-Regulating Resistance: The more difficult you pedal, the more resistance you deal with.5. Service warranty and ServiceValue of Warranty: A robust warranty can provide assurance, protecting the investment against problems.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)What is the average rate of a stationary bicycle?
Costs can range significantly based on the type and functions, from as low as ₤ 200 for standard designs to over ₤ 2,000 for high-end commercial bikes.
How much space do I need for an exercise bike?
While upright bikes need less area, recumbent and hybrid bikes might require more room. Assess your designated exercise area and measure appropriately.
Are exercise bikes appropriate for users of all fitness levels?
Yes, stationary bicycle for Exercise At home are flexible and accommodate all fitness levels. Many deal adjustable resistance settings to accommodate newbies and advanced users alike.
Can I discover stationary bicycle with interactive workouts?
Definitely. Numerous modern bikes feature Bluetooth capability that enables users to gain access to different online platforms using classes and customized exercises.
What maintenance is required for a stationary bicycle?
Regular look at the bike's hardware, cleaning, and periodic lubrication will help maintain performance and extend lifespan.
